Transaction 56e21bdc6eb8c4475773cd52e0063551da07e6a39a417cadc2f9681c112434f3

1 Input
2 Outputs
  • 56e21bdc6eb8c4475773cd52e0063551da07e6a39a417cadc2f9681c112434f3:0
  • value  80000
    address  3HdDefx2o1RS5UFCatuWXY1WfjVmF2MA2g
  • 56e21bdc6eb8c4475773cd52e0063551da07e6a39a417cadc2f9681c112434f3:1
  • value  20152193
    address  3QiThhfA4wwRRX2Wbyfu21p11YU8ziDWzq